Embodiment 1

[0028] A method for assisting the production of transparent paper with regenerated cellulose, comprising the following steps and process conditions:

[0029] (1) Dissolution of cellulose powder: first dissolve 0.2g cellulose powder in 3ml EMIMMeOPO 2 In the H ionic liquid, heat at 85°C, and the cellulose is completely dissolved in about 16 minutes;

[0030] (2) Preparation of regenerated cellulose solution: 12 g of dimethyl sulfoxide solvent was added to 300 g of deionized water, and heated at 85° C. for 10 min to obtain a regenerated cellulose solution.

[0031] (3) Preparation of regenerated cellulose: Slowly add the solution of dissolving cellulose powder obtained through step (1) into the regenerated cellulose solution obtained through step (2) which is being stirred at high speed. Abstract

The invention discloses transparent paper supplementary with regenerated cellulose and a manufacturing method thereof. The method comprises the following steps: firstly, adding fine cellulose powder into EMIMMeOPO2H ionic liquid; heating cellulose till fully dissolving; slowly adding the cellulose solution into a regenerating solution under quick stirring state; cutting a large amount of accumulated cellulose molecules into countless small cellulose molecule groups under the high-speed shearing effect of an emulsifying machine, wherein the small groups are regenerated cellulose; mixing the regenerated cellulose with fully pulped plant fibers and forming into an end product of paper. The thickness of the transparent paper is 30-100mu m, the light transmissivity is 60-90%, the tensile strength is 20-60 Mpa and the stretch rate is (10-30)%. According to the invention, paper pulp is taken as the raw material, the process is environmentally friendly, the cost is low, the production period is short, only 30-120min is required by the whole process, the present paper machine, technique and equipment are locally modified and the industrial production can be achieved.

Description

technical field [0001] The present invention relates to a kind of rapid preparation method of transparent paper, especially relate to a kind of transparent paper and its method that are assisted by regenerated cellulose, and this transparent paper can be applied to organic light-emitting diode, display device, transistor, solar cell, supercapacitor and other flexible electronic devices. Background technique [0002] As an emerging high-performance transparent substrate, transparent paper has the advantages of low-carbon environmental protection, curlability, high processing temperature, and good printability. In recent years, very gratifying successful application experience has been obtained in the fields of flexible organic light-emitting diodes, display devices, transistors, solar cells, supercapacitors and other flexible electronic devices, which has attracted strong attention from all over the world.
